Document: The function of the coronaviral X-domain is still unclear; for some coronaviruses such as HCoV 229E and SARS-CoV, it has been shown to exhibit a low ADP-ribose-10-phosphate phosphatase (Appr-10-pase, occasionally also called ''ADRP'') activity and to bind the product of the reaction, ADP-ribose [21] [22] [23] 30] . However, the two subdomains of SUD core do not bind ADPribose, as we have demonstrated by zone-interference gel electrophoresis ( Figure S1 ).
